NTT DATA Calls for Urgent Action on AI Energy Consumption and Sustainability
What Happened
NTT DATA, a leading global IT services provider, has sounded the alarm on the escalating energy consumption associated with artificial intelligence technologies. In a recent statement, the company stressed that as AI models and applications proliferate across industries, their appetite for computing power is outpacing sustainability initiatives. NTT DATA noted that the carbon footprint of AI systems is becoming a pressing issue, with environmental impacts drawing increased scrutiny from policymakers and stakeholders. The firm urges the tech industry, governments, and researchers to collaborate on more energy-efficient hardware, innovative cooling techniques, and greener data centers to stem AI’s environmental toll.
Why It Matters
The call for urgent action spotlights a critical challenge as AI adoption accelerates worldwide: how to balance technological advancement with environmental responsibility.
